Golden Eagle Softball Heads Out to Minot for Non-Conference Doubleheader with Minot State

3/2/2022 9:31:00 AM

Crookston, Minn. – After playing outside for the first time this past weekend in Topeka, Kan., Minnesota Crookston softball will head back inside, as they travel to Minot to play Minot State in a pair of non-conference games on Sunday afternoon inside the Minot State bubble.
 
Minnesota Crookston finished the four-game stretch in Kansas with a record of 1-3, with their lone win coming in the first game over Newman University, 8-4. The Golden Eagles are 7-8 on the season.

Minnesota Crookston (7-8)
In their first time playing outside, the Golden Eagles finished 1-3 in Kansas, including a win against the Jets of Newman University and a one-run loss against Emporia State.
 
The Golden Eagles have had good performances by a trio of hitters this season. Alina Avalos (Jr., IF, Riverside, Calif.) is off to a blazing start this season, hitting .408 with a home run and 12 RBI's. The junior also has an OPS of over 1.000. Whitnee Curry (Fr., IF, Omaha, Neb.) is hitting .405 on the season and has a hit in all but three games this season. Jordan Peterson (R-Sr., UT, Lakeville, Minn.) is hitting .361 and has driven in 12 runs this season. As a team, the Golden Eagles hit .277.
 
In the circle, the maroon and gold have been led by youngster Evie Stuck (Fr., P/OF, Papillion, Neb.). The freshman is 5-2 in eight appearances and seven starts. The Nebraskan also has six complete games and an ERA of just 2.87. Stuck also leads the NSIC in innings pitched at 46.1. Kamryn Frisk (R-Sr., P/1B, Anchorage, AK) has also been good in over 22 innings of work and two starts.
 
Minot State (10-3)
The Beavers have not lost a step after clinching an NSIC playoff berth last season. Minot State is 10-3 this season, including a win over the Golden Eagles already this season.
 
One thing that has led the Beavers to success this season has been their balance up and down their lineup. Minot State has six hitters all hitting over .320 and all six have started in 10 or more games this season. Jamie Odlum leads the Beavers with a .553 average and nine extra base-hits, including six doubles, while also driving in 11 runs. Maggie Mercer and Kiera Shwaluk are each hitting over .400 on the season as well. After leading the nation in stolen bases in 2021, Minot State is back to their bag-stealing ways. The Beavers have already stolen 53 bases on 61 attempts, including a perfect 8 for 8 on stolen base attempts by Jazmin Karanungan.
 
The Beavers have one of the best pitching staffs in the entire conference. Their 2.70 ERA currently ranks sixth in the NSIC and have been led by Trinity Valentine and her 1.41 ERA, which is top-five. The Las Vegas native has 38 strikeouts in just 34.2 innings of work as well. Jazmine Blizzard, Zoya Robbins and Reegan Floyd have combined to make 13 appearances and each have an ERA of under 3.50.
